Advanced Soccer Coaching and Sports Psychology

Sports, Recreation and Exercise QQI Award (6M5147)

The aim of the course is to provide students with industry ready qualifications to obtain a sustainable career within Sport and Exercise Sciences. The Advanced Soccer Coaching & Sports Psychology course is unique because along with the QQI level 6 award students can undertake ITEC Gym Instruction within the Sports Management and Personal Training.

Course Content

Exercise and Fitness (6N5345); Work Experience (6N1946); Team Leadership (6N1948); Soccer Coaching (6N5189); Sports Industry Practice (6N4650); Sport Psychology (6N4665); Sport Nutrition (6N4651); Health Promotion (6N2214)

Certification

  • QQI Level 6 Award in Sports, Recreation and Exercise (6M5147)
  • ITEC Qualification in Gym Instruction
  • UEFA Coaching Licence

Duration

1 year – September to May (full-time)

Entry Requirements

It is compulsory that potential candidates have at least a QQI level 5 certificate in Sport & Recreation (or a relevant cogent qualification). Experience and interest in soccer/coaching is essential. The student will be required to perform a practical interview on sport competencies and a formal interview with the course coordinator. Successful completion of the Leaving Certificate is desirable but not essential.

Third Level Links/Progression

This course is suitable for learners who intend to continue their studies in a third level educational institute. Successful graduates, through the Higher Education Links Scheme, may work towards a diploma or degree in nutrition, science or related areas. For more information, click here
